Self-study: Summary for BBC Today, 7h13, 6th Jan, 2009

Dr. Musa told the reporter that on 5th Jan, 2009, Tony Blair headed a convoy to Gaza strip, increasing the diplomatic activities and international efforts here, but the whole challenges have remained and the fighting continues. The Hamas militia and Israel forces exchanged fire and try to catch each other in Gaza. Hamas Islamic fighters were said to use anti-tank weapons, motars to fire with machine guns and they said they would force Israel to pay a heavy price. The casualies are difficult to count, depending on which side's declaration. Hamas said to kill 10 Israel soldiers over night, but Israel dismissed and in contrary, Israel stated to kill more than 130 Hamas fighters over 2 days and captured 100 others, in fact, many civilians wounded to be taken to the hospital.

As a witness saying, the fighting is more serious with many explosions, bombing, especially at night, he heard people call for help. Nothan, representative chief of Gierusalem Bureau assessed that Israel troops tried to reach Hamas military positions and infrastructure, they are now in dangerous situation. They are difficult to know exact targets because they confused Hamas fighters with citizens. Gaza can be discribed as a combination of Iraq and Afghanistan./.
